DALA’s Young Children’s Program is where the joy of dance begins! Designed for our youngest movers ages 18 months-12 years, this program nurtures imagination, confidence, coordination, and a love of movement that can last a lifetime, whether your child dances for one year or one hundred. Our Young Children’s classes balance play with technique and build into our Classical Ballet and Mixed Repertoire Programs with an audition-only Winter Performance and in-class preparation for the spring Young Children’s Showcase. Through imaginative lessons, progressive skill-building, creative problem-solving, and exciting performance opportunities, DALA’s Young Children’s Program helps students build confidence, friendships, and a lifelong love of movement while developing the strong foundations for any future dance journey!
Young dancers at DALA can progress through our programing from Creative Movement, Dance Exploration, and Pre-Ballet, all the way to Level 1, Level 1/2, and Beginning Level where we introduce a wide variety of styles, including Ballet, Modern, Jazz, Tap, Flamenco, Scottish Highland, Contemporary, Musical Theatre, Hip Hop, Tumbling, and more.
